Output d84b731e1a6730eb456a2feae8791bd5c99809114a3ffd0aa47daaf71a6df784:3

value
50983815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 faa2fcb24096952344be14488be70e3ddda8c32a OP_EQUAL
address
MWkQQvshQR364ZhQ7FJep2UsepHc7JSyyf
transaction
d84b731e1a6730eb456a2feae8791bd5c99809114a3ffd0aa47daaf71a6df784
spent
true